fuboTV DVR
One of the nice benefits of fuboTV is a DVR which includes 250 hours of storage, included at no extra charge. You can record all of your favorite content and watch it later, with no time limits. If you need more storage, you can boost your DVR to 1,000 hours for a $16.99/month fee, or by upgrading to the Elite package.
fuboTV also offers a 72-hour “rewind” feature, which lets you watch most shows and events up to 72 hours after they’ve aired, even if you forgot to record them. Learn more here.

AT&T TV DVR
If you choose a contract-free AT&T TV subscription, you’ll be limited to a 20-hour DVR, which can be upgraded for a $9.99/monthly fee. It also has a 90-day content expiration limit.
However, if you choose a contract plan, you’ll get the 500-hour DVR for no additional charge. Learn more here.

NESNgo

One of the best things about using an internet TV service to get NESN is that, like using a traditional cable provider, you can use your login information to access first-party streams from NESN, using the NESNgo website and app.
The NESNgo website and app allow you to watch live and on-demand content from NESN, directly from your computer or mobile device. Interestingly, only fuboTV currently supports NESN logins. You use your fuboTV login to access NESNgo, but AT&T TV doesn’t support it at the moment, which is a bit disappointing.
Why would you want to use NESNgo, rather than your fuboTV subscription? Well, the main reason is that streaming content using NESNgo doesn’t count towards your simultaneous stream limit. If your family is watching YouTube TV content on 3 devices at once, you can still log into NESNgo, and watch the Boston Bruins or the Red Sox live, without exceeding your 3-device limit.
NESNgo is a bit primitive and the mobile app has pretty bad reviews, and does not support Amazon Fire TV, Roku, Chromecast or Apple TV – but it does its job, and the fact you can access it with fuboTV means that services are even more attractive if you want to watch NESN without cable.
